from fastapi import APIRouter, Depends, Query, HTTPException
from sqlalchemy.ext.asyncio import AsyncSession
from sqlalchemy import select, func, cast, Date, and_
from datetime import datetime, timedelta
from typing import Dict, Any, Optional
from ..core.dependencies import get_current_active_user
from ..db.database import get_db
from ..db.models import Order, Product, User

router = APIRouter()

@router.get("/sales")
async def get_sales_analytics(

    start_date: datetime = Query(default=None),

    end_date: datetime = Query(default=None),

    branch_id: Optional[int] = Query(None, description="Filter analytics by branch"),

    current_user: User = Depends(get_current_active_user),

    db: AsyncSession = Depends(get_db)

) -> Dict[str, Any]:
    if not start_date:
        start_date = datetime.now() - timedelta(days=30)
    if not end_date:
        end_date = datetime.now()
    
    # Build query conditions
    conditions = [
        Order.created_at.between(start_date, end_date),
        Order.status.in_(['completed', 'delivered'])
    ]
    
    # Add branch filter
    if branch_id:
        if not current_user.is_superuser and branch_id != current_user.branch_id:
            raise HTTPException(
                status_code=403,
                detail="You can only view analytics from your own branch"
            )
        conditions.append(Order.branch_id == branch_id)
    elif not current_user.is_superuser:
        # Non-superusers can only see their branch's analytics
        conditions.append(Order.branch_id == current_user.branch_id)
    
    # Daily sales query
    stmt = select(
        cast(Order.created_at, Date).label('date'),
        func.sum(Order.total_amount).label('total_sales'),
        func.count().label('order_count')
    ).where(
        and_(*conditions)
    ).group_by(
        cast(Order.created_at, Date)
    ).order_by(
        cast(Order.created_at, Date)
    )
    
    result = await db.execute(stmt)
    daily_sales = result.all()
    
    # Calculate totals
    total_revenue = sum(day.total_sales for day in daily_sales)
    total_orders = sum(day.order_count for day in daily_sales)
    avg_order_value = total_revenue / total_orders if total_orders > 0 else 0
    
    return {
        "daily_sales": [
            {"date": day.date, "total_sales": day.total_sales, "order_count": day.order_count}
            for day in daily_sales
        ],
        "total_revenue": total_revenue,
        "total_orders": total_orders,
        "average_order_value": avg_order_value
    }

@router.get("/products")
async def get_product_analytics(

    branch_id: Optional[int] = Query(None, description="Filter analytics by branch"),

    current_user: User = Depends(get_current_active_user),

    db: AsyncSession = Depends(get_db)

) -> Dict[str, Any]:
    # Build base conditions
    conditions = []
    
    # Add branch filter
    if branch_id:
        if not current_user.is_superuser and branch_id != current_user.branch_id:
            raise HTTPException(
                status_code=403,
                detail="You can only view analytics from your own branch"
            )
        conditions.append(Product.branch_id == branch_id)
    elif not current_user.is_superuser:
        conditions.append(Product.branch_id == current_user.branch_id)
    
    # Top selling products
    stmt = select(
        Product,
        func.sum(Order.total_amount).label('total_revenue'),
        func.count().label('total_orders')
    ).join(
        Order, Product.id == Order.id
    ).where(
        and_(*conditions)
    ).group_by(
        Product.id
    ).order_by(
        func.sum(Order.total_amount).desc()
    ).limit(10)
    
    result = await db.execute(stmt)
    top_products = result.all()
    
    # Count total and low stock products
    total_products = await db.scalar(
        select(func.count()).select_from(Product).where(and_(*conditions))
    )
    
    low_stock_conditions = conditions + [Product.inventory_count < 10]
    low_stock_count = await db.scalar(
        select(func.count()).select_from(Product).where(and_(*low_stock_conditions))
    )
    
    return {
        "top_products": [
            {
                "id": product.id,
                "name": product.name,
                "total_revenue": revenue,
                "total_orders": orders
            }
            for product, revenue, orders in top_products
        ],
        "total_products": total_products,
        "low_stock_products": low_stock_count
    }

@router.get("/customers")
async def get_customer_analytics(

    branch_id: Optional[int] = Query(None, description="Filter analytics by branch"),

    current_user: User = Depends(get_current_active_user),

    db: AsyncSession = Depends(get_db)

) -> Dict[str, Any]:
    # Build base conditions
    conditions = []
    
    # Add branch filter
    if branch_id:
        if not current_user.is_superuser and branch_id != current_user.branch_id:
            raise HTTPException(
                status_code=403,
                detail="You can only view analytics from your own branch"
            )
        conditions.append(Order.branch_id == branch_id)
    elif not current_user.is_superuser:
        conditions.append(Order.branch_id == current_user.branch_id)
    
    # Customer statistics
    stmt = select(
        User,
        func.sum(Order.total_amount).label('total_spent'),
        func.count().label('total_orders')
    ).join(
        Order, User.id == Order.customer_id
    ).where(
        and_(*conditions)
    ).group_by(
        User.id
    ).order_by(
        func.sum(Order.total_amount).desc()
    )
    
    result = await db.execute(stmt)
    customer_data = result.all()
    
    total_customers = len(customer_data)
    total_revenue = sum(spent for _, spent, _ in customer_data)
    avg_customer_value = total_revenue / total_customers if total_customers > 0 else 0
    
    # Customer segments
    segments = {
        "high_value": len([c for c, spent, _ in customer_data if spent > 1000]),
        "medium_value": len([c for c, spent, _ in customer_data if 500 <= spent <= 1000]),
        "low_value": len([c for c, spent, _ in customer_data if spent < 500])
    }
    
    return {
        "total_customers": total_customers,
        "average_customer_value": avg_customer_value,
        "customer_segments": segments,
        "top_customers": [
            {
                "id": customer.id,
                "email": customer.email,
                "total_spent": spent,
                "total_orders": orders
            }
            for customer, spent, orders in customer_data[:10]  # Top 10 customers
        ]
    }

@router.get("/dashboard")
async def get_dashboard_analytics(

    branch_id: Optional[int] = Query(None, description="Filter analytics by branch"),

    current_user: User = Depends(get_current_active_user),

    db: AsyncSession = Depends(get_db)

) -> Dict[str, Any]:
    """Get a comprehensive dashboard with key metrics"""
    # Get last 30 days of sales data
    start_date = datetime.now() - timedelta(days=30)
    end_date = datetime.now()
    
    sales_data = await get_sales_analytics(start_date, end_date, branch_id, current_user, db)
    product_data = await get_product_analytics(branch_id, current_user, db)
    customer_data = await get_customer_analytics(branch_id, current_user, db)
    
    return {
        "sales_summary": {
            "total_revenue": sales_data["total_revenue"],
            "total_orders": sales_data["total_orders"],
            "average_order_value": sales_data["average_order_value"],
            "daily_sales": sales_data["daily_sales"][-7:]  # Last 7 days
        },
        "product_summary": {
            "total_products": product_data["total_products"],
            "low_stock_products": product_data["low_stock_products"],
            "top_selling_products": product_data["top_products"][:5]  # Top 5 products
        },
        "customer_summary": {
            "total_customers": customer_data["total_customers"],
            "average_customer_value": customer_data["average_customer_value"],
            "customer_segments": customer_data["customer_segments"]
        }
    }
